Morton played well junior year, but getting reps behind multiple FBS targets that were senior made for a highlight reel that didn’t quite catch college scouts’ attention. Well head into senior year, where the opportunities are high, and Morton is making the best of them. What has always stood out about Morton is ability to adjust to the pass, he’s especially good at back shoulder throws on the sideline. He’s a very good athlete once he gets into the open field. Good ball, skills for a projected slot receiver, but has the skills to split out wide too due to quick release up field. Route running is good, he doesn’t explode out his breaks completely, but sells his route well. Needs to be more concise with his footwork though. Morton just has a natural feel at measuring up the pass, and doing a really good job of shielding defender from the football. He’s by far one of the true breakout players in the state of Georgia, and it’s not just making tough catches, he’s now a lot more dangerous after the catch making defenders miss and just has that nose for extra yardage.
